Prompt
Create a stormwater strategy diagram for a landscape scheme, drawn as a flat analytical plan. Show the site plan in a quiet grey register with buildings, paving and planting distinguished only by tone. Overlay the water logic in blue: arrows following the surface falls across each paved area, thicker lines where flow concentrates, a dashed outline marking each permeable zone, and shaded blue polygons showing the swales and the detention basin with their storage volume noted. Detail the sequence with numbered markers along a single route — roof, downpipe, rill, swale, basin, overflow — each keyed to a short caption at the side. Show contour lines as fine dashed curves with spot levels at the high and low points so the fall direction is verifiable. Add a small section inset at the bottom cutting through the swale, showing its profile, planting and the water level in a storm. Flat technical diagram, white background, blue on grey, no photorealism.
